I recently read a book called "Talent Is Overrated: What Really Separates World-Class Performers from Everybody Else," by Geoffrey Colvin.

Colvin sets out to demonstrate that "world-class performers," compared to performers at the next level down, did not start out with greater innate abilities.

Instead, they simply worked harder and longer. Sometimes they had unusual opportunities, but we usually think of that as "luck" or "good fortune" rather than talent.

In a way, Colvin isn't talking about "talent" at all. Talent is a word we usually use for youngsters or relative beginners. "He has a real talent for the piano," we might say of a child who masters each lesson easily — but we'd never say that about Vladimir Ashkenazy.
